/aw_emu

Allwinner low-level emulator, used for debugging baremetal payloads.

Primary LanguageC++MIT LicenseMIT

aw_emu

Allwinner low-level emulator, used for debugging baremetal payloads. Currently only Allwinner A133 is supported, other Allwinner SoC's are unsupported.

Why?

I'm lazy, and this was easier than constantly testing my baremetal payloads on real hardware. I also could've implemented support for any Allwinner SoC I wanted to emulate into QEMU, but, I prefer emulating an SoC using the Unicorn framework, because it's simple.